gKteso is a Germany-based supplier of medical technology and industrial high-precision systems. It provides OEM customers with modular subsystems, custom development, engineering design, prototype validation, and certified manufacturing. According to its website, its key focus areas include radiotherapy, imaging, ophthalmic motion systems, QA phantoms, interventional radiology, and industrial automation. Strictly speaking, it is not a typical SaaS or enterprise software provider, but a B2B engineering services company combining hardware, electromechanics, software/firmware engineering, and compliant manufacturing.
In the medical field, gKteso offers radiotherapy patient-positioning platforms, multi-leaf collimator (MLC) beam-shaping systems, ophthalmic patient-positioning/motion systems, water-equivalent QA phantoms, and interventional radiology imaging solutions. Its MLC offerings cover standard 120-leaf systems, miniature robotic MLCs, and custom solutions for scenarios such as MRI compatibility and FLASH. Its Design as a Service approach emphasizes support from early sketches, industrial design, risk analysis, and material/mechanical feasibility through to 3D printing/CNC rapid prototyping and design validation for mass production. In terms of integration, the site mentions connectivity with linear accelerators, hospital IT systems, and existing OEM product portfolios.

Its compliance positioning is clearer: the site mentions ISO 13485, ISO 9001, CE/FDA-ready, CE/MDR, MDR/FDA validation processes, as well as support for risk management and usability documentation. This makes it relevant for OEM projects with demanding medical device registration and global market-entry requirements.
Its strengths are a complete engineering chain covering concept, prototyping, design, electromechanical/software development, and mass production. The site also provides relatively detailed positioning in radiotherapy, ophthalmology, and high-precision motion control, backed by two sites in Germany, 6000 square meters of production space, and 35 years of experience. The drawbacks are limited commercial transparency: there is no standardized pricing, SLA, delivery timeline, or clear description of software product capabilities. It is not a good fit for companies looking to buy ready-to-use SaaS. It is better suited to medical device OEMs, radiotherapy/imaging system manufacturers, clinical innovation teams, and industrial automation project owners.
